Thank you so much for this little tip, it got me going fine. 



For info, I set up edubuntu in vmware server (with two NICS) then
created a thin clinet in vmware server as well. Vmware has spare
virtual nics for additional nics but you might find that most of them
do not work. My untampered vmware install allowed /dev/vmnet8 to work.
Also make sure you use a different subnet for the 2nd nic in edubuntu
and on your thin client if you are already on a LAN, e.g. my LAN runs
on 10.10.10.0 and edubuntu runs on 192.168.0.0.
